A coin is tossed and six sided die numbered 1 through 6 is rolled. Find the probability of tossing a tail and then rolling a number greater than 1.
Answer:
5/12
Step-by-step explanation:
A coin has two faces (H, T)
n(S) = 2 (sample space)
If it is tossed and a rail is gotten,
n(E) = 1 (event)
Probability of tossing a tail = n(E)/n(S)) = 1/2
If a dice is rolled, the sample space S = {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6}
n(S) = 6
Number greater than 1 are the evens E = {2, 3, 4, 5, 6}
n(E) = 5
pr(rolling a number greater than 1) = 5/6
Hence the probability of tossing a tail and then rolling a number greater than 1 = 1/2 * 5/6
= 5/12

A diver is on a diving board 12 meters above the water. He dives vertically from the board with initial velocity of 4.9 meter/sec. how high will the diver get above the water?
Answer:
13.225 m
Step-by-step explanation:
Given that :
Initial Velocity, u = 4.9m/s
Acceleration due to gravity, a = - 9.8 m/s² (downward)
Distance, S = - 12
According to the motion equation :
S = ut + 0.5at²
S = 4.9t + 0.5(-9.8)t²
S = 4.9t - 4.9t² - - - (1)
At the highest point, v = 0
v² = u + at
0 = 4.9 + - 9.8t
-9.8t = - 4.9
t = 4.9/9.8
t = 0.5s
Put t = 0.5 in (1) above
S = 4.9(0.5) - 4.9(0.5)²
S = 2.45 - 1.225
S = 1.225 m
Total height :
(12 + 1.225) m = 13.225 m

a. p = 5t + 4
b. a = t2 - 4
c. d = t(5 – f)
Make t the subject in the formulas
Answer:
a, t = (p - 4)/5
b. t =√(a + 4)
c. t = d/(5-f)
Step-by-step explanation:
a. p = 5t + 4
To make t the subject of the equation, subtract 4 from both sides
p - 4 = 5t + 4 - 4
p - 4 = 5t
Divide both sides by 5
(p - 4)/5 = t
t = (p - 4)/5
b. a = t2 - 4
to make t the subject, add 4 to both sides
a + 4 = t2 - 4 + 4
a + 4 = t2
find the root of both sides
t =√(a + 4)
c. d = t(5 – f)
to make t the subject, divide both sides by 5 - f
d/(5-f) = t(5 – f)/(5 – f)
t = d/(5-f)

Adult tickets to the fall play cost $6 and student tickets cost $3. The drama class sold 25 more student tickets than adult tickets to the fall play. If the class collected $660 from ticket sales, how many student tickets were sold?
The drama class sold how many tickets?
The solution is?
9514 1404 393
Answer:
90 student tickets65 adult ticketsStep-by-step explanation:
For many "mixture" problems, it is convenient to use a variable for the quantity of the highest contributor. Here, we can use 'a' to represent the number of adult tickets, because adult tickets cost the most. Then the number of student tickets is (a+25), and the total revenue is ...
6a +3(a+25) = 660
9a +75 = 660
9a = 585
a = 65
(a+25) = 90
The drama class sold 90 student tickets and 65 adult tickets.
